This is my second post of the day. The deadline for The Paper Players is fast approaching and I just saw it this morning. Nothing like quickly making a card to keep you on your toes.
Joanne asked for a single stamped image on a clean and simple card and since I need alcohol marker practice and would like to add to my sympathy stash, I decided on these Penny Black Calla lilies called Elegance. They are stamped in Memento London Fog and colored with Altenew artist markers. The sentiment is also from Penny Black.
